The world of luxury watches has always been a fascination for many, with timepieces often symbolizing status, wealth, and sophistication. However, when it comes to the Rolex owned by the notorious drug lord Pablo Escobar, the story behind this particular timepiece is far from glamorous. Recently, Escobar's diamond-encrusted gold Rolex was auctioned off by authorities in his native Colombia, shedding light on the dark history behind this extravagant accessory.

Escobar's $70k Watch was Sold for Just $8,500

The Guardian reported that Escobar's Rolex, which was initially valued at $70,000, was sold at auction for a mere $8,500. This significant drop in price reflects not only the tarnished reputation of the infamous drug lord but also the controversial nature of owning a timepiece with such a dark past. Despite its luxurious appearance and high-end craftsmanship, the Rolex's association with Escobar's criminal activities undoubtedly impacted its perceived value.
